Carlos Alcaraz Triumphs at US Open 2025, Reclaims World No. 1 Ranking

Carlos Alcaraz delivered a spectacular performance in New York on Sunday, clinching the US Open 2025 title. The Spanish player defeated Italy's talented tennis player, Jannik Sinner, in straight sets in the final.

Sports News: Spain's young tennis star Carlos Alcaraz made history on Sunday by winning the US Open 2025 title. He defeated Italy's Jannik Sinner in a tough contest with a score of 6-2, 3-6, 6-1, 6-4, securing his sixth Grand Slam title and reclaiming the World No. 1 spot in the ITF rankings. This is his second US Open victory, and at the age of 22, this achievement places him among the most influential players in the tennis world.

Alcaraz's Dominance in the Final Match

From the outset of the match, Alcaraz displayed brilliant play, securing the first set 6-2. He broke Sinner's serve in the very first game and maintained his dominance throughout the set. In the second set, Sinner made a comeback and won 6-3, making the contest thrilling. However, in the third set, Alcaraz showcased his strength and tactical prowess to win the set 6-1 in his favor. He demonstrated excellent control in the fourth set as well, registering a 6-4 victory to claim the title.

With this victory, Alcaraz regained the World No. 1 ranking for the first time since September 2023. Despite numerous ups and downs over the past two years, his performance proves he is not only a talented player but also mentally very b. His name is now added to the list of legends who have won multiple Grand Slams at a young age.

Jannik Sinner's Winning Streak Ends

Jannik Sinner's impressive run on hard courts has now come to an end. Before this match, he had recorded a streak of 27 consecutive wins. Sinner had previously faced defeat against Alcaraz in the French Open final in June. After the match, Sinner stated, "I gave my best. I couldn't have played any better today." Although this loss might be disappointing, his playing style and determination won the hearts of the spectators.
